Mapping the Primordial Universe: Theory and Observations of the Cosmic Microwave Background Bucher, Martin (Universite Paris Cite / CNRS)
Mapping the Primordial Universe: Theory and Observations of the Cosmic Microwave Background
Bucher, Martin (Universite Paris Cite / CNRS)
A comprehensive pedagogical overview of the theory and observations of Cosmic Microwave Background radiation which also covers instrumentation, statistical analyses and the astrophysics of Galactic and other microwave foregrounds. With the latest research and developments, this is a go-to resource for graduate students and researchers in cosmology.
